10 Best Fruits For Pregnant Women: Key Benefits & Nutrients
1: Banana
Bananas are high in potassium and help manage pregnancy-related fatigue, bloating, and muscle cramps. They also support healthy blood pressure levels and can ease morning sickness.
Thus, they're a must-have among fruits for pregnant ladies! It's also quite beneficial that they're filling and easy to digest.
2: Apples
Apple is a crunchy and fibre-rich fruit that supports digestion and immunity. They also provide vitamin C and antioxidants, which contribute to the baby’s overall growth.
3: Oranges
Oranges are packed with vitamin C and folate. These are necessary for fetal development and collagen production.
Their high water content keeps the body hydrated. Hence, they're a refreshing addition to your list of fruits for pregnant cravings.
4: Berries
Berries are rich in antioxidants that can help to reduce oxidative stress. They’re low in calories and high in fibre. Hence, they're perfect fruits for pregnancy if you want to snack between meals.
5: Mangoes
Mangoes provide vitamin A, which is essential for your baby’s immune system and vision. Their natural sweetness also satisfies sugar cravings healthily.
6: Pomegranates
The high iron content in pomegranates helps to prevent anemia and promote healthy blood flow to the fetus.
They’re also rich in antioxidants, which makes them excellent fruits for pregnant women with low haemoglobin.
7: Guavas
This one is a tropical fruit loaded with folic acid and vitamin C! Guavas help in preventing neural birth defects and boosting maternal immunity.
8: Kiwi
Kiwis support iron absorption and are high in fibre and vitamin K. They also quicken digestion and reduce the risk of blood clotting for pregnant women.
9: Ripe Papaya
Ripe papayas are a good source of beta-carotene and promote better digestion. However, unripe papayas must be strictly avoided. In moderation, ripe papayas can be considered safe fruits for pregnancy.

10: Chikoo
Chikoo helps in regulating bowel movements and keeps blood sugar levels in check. Its natural sweetness makes it one of the tastiest fruits for pregnant women to enjoy in small portions.
10 Best Dry Fruits For Pregnant Women: Key Benefits & Nutrients
1: Almonds
Almonds are packed with healthy fats, calcium, and protein. They support fetal bone development and help regulate blood sugar levels. Soaked almonds are perfect dry fruits for pregnant women!
2: Walnuts
Walnuts are a powerhouse of omega-3 fatty acids! They support the development of the baby’s brain and nervous system.
3: Cashews
Cashews are a great source of iron and magnesium. They promote red blood cell production and energy. Perfect dry fruits for pregnant ladies with low energy levels.
4: Pistachios
Pistachios are rich in protein, fibre, and healthy fats. These support heart health and help control blood sugar. Their anti-inflammatory properties make them good dry fruits for pregnant ladies!
5: Dates
Dates are known to ease labour and improve cervical readiness in the final weeks. Their natural sugars provide quick energy!

6: Raisins
These tiny powerhouses are excellent for boosting iron and calcium. Raisins also help relieve constipation, which is a common pregnancy issue.
7: Figs
Figs are rich in fibre and calcium. They improve bone health and smooth digestion. If you soak them overnight, they can be great dry fruits for pregnant lady morning routines.
8: Dried Apricots
Dried apricots are loaded with iron, potassium, and beta-carotene! They can help to manage anemia and support eye development in the baby.
9: Dried Cranberries
These tart snacks are full of antioxidants and help prevent urinary tract infections, which are common during pregnancy.
10: Prunes
Prunes are known for their constipation-relieving benefits. Hence, they're a go-to among dry fruits for pregnant women facing digestion troubles!

How To Add Fruits & Dry Fruits To Your Pregnancy Diet
1: Morning Routine
Start your day with a smoothie made of bananas, berries, and yogurt. Add chia seeds and crushed dry fruits like almonds or walnuts for extra nutrition.
2: Mid-Meal Snack
Keep sliced apples or pomegranate seeds handy. Pair them with a few soaked figs or raisins to boost iron and fibre.
3: Main Meals
Add fruits to salads—like oranges in leafy greens or kiwi in side dishes. Even dals or rice can be garnished with chopped dates and pistachios.
4: Evening Time
Prepare a trail mix with walnuts, cranberries, and cashews. It’s a healthy option to curb hunger without junk food.
5: Dessert Swap
Bake an apple or mango with cinnamon, or enjoy frozen banana bites dipped in dark chocolate!
6: Before Bed
A glass of warm milk with crushed almonds or dates can calm the body and promote restful sleep.

FAQs on Fruits and Dry Fruits for Pregnant Women
Q1: What are the best fruits for pregnant women to eat?
Bananas, apples, oranges, pomegranates, and berries are among the best fruits for pregnant women. They offer folate, fibre, and antioxidants to support fetal development and maternal health.
Q2: Which fruits are most beneficial during pregnancy?
Mangoes, guavas, kiwis, and ripe papayas provide vitamins, iron, and hydration. They improve digestion, immunity, and energy levels.
Q3: Can dry fruits be included in a pregnant woman's diet?
Yes! Dry fruits are rich in iron, calcium, and omega-3s. When consumed in moderation, they enhance energy, support fetal development, and reduce constipation.
Q4: What are the best dry fruits for pregnant women?
Almonds, walnuts, pistachios, dates, and figs are the best dry fruits. They regulate blood sugar, boost brain development, and support immunity.
Q5: Are there any fruits to avoid during pregnancy?
Yes. Avoid unripe papaya, excess pineapple, and grapes in late pregnancy. Always choose seasonal, fresh, and clean fruits, preferably after consulting your doctor.
